How to drain and dry a wet-dry vac: step-by-step

Anything less than complete draining invites a mess. Follow these steps every time:

  1. Power off and unplug — ensure the motor has stopped and the unit is cool.
  2. Remove collection tank — separate the tank or recovery bin from the motor housing.
  3. Open all valves — remove drain plugs and any inline traps. Tip the tank to extract residual fluid.
  4. Detach hoses and accessories — empty and inspect each piece.
  5. Rinse and repeat — rinse with clean water if the tank contained greasy or soiled liquid; follow with a clean-water rinse.
  6. Dry mechanically — use compressed air or towels to remove film moisture from corners and ridges.
  7. Use desiccants — add silica gel packs or commercial desiccant pads to absorb remaining moisture for transit.
  8. Run a short vacuum cycle — if safe and recommended by the manufacturer, run the motor briefly to clear residual moisture from hoses and pump housings (check manufacturer guidance first).

Practical tips from fulfillment operations

In high-volume fulfillment centers we recommend a two-person drain-and-inspect station: one person drains and rinses, the second performs a dry check, installs desiccants and takes photographs. This reduces human error and creates consistent documentation for claims.

Sealing and absorbent packing: stop leaks when they happen

No packing system is perfect. The goal is to limit the volume of any potential leak and prevent liquid from reaching the outer carton or pallet.

Inner containment

  • Food-grade heavy-duty bags (2–6 mil) — double-bag the tank and any removable components. Use a heat sealer or industrial tape to close bags.
  • Absorbent pads — place high-capacity pads inside the tank and around the motor mounts. Replace pads for returns and inspections.
  • Secondary liners — cross-bagging: tank in a sealed bag, then the whole unit in a VCI bag for corrosion protection.

Outer protection

  • Double-box for small units — inner box cushioned with foam or corrugated corners inside a reinforced outer box.
  • Palletize heavy vacs — strap to a pallet, use corner boards, and shrink-wrap fully. For concentrations of multiple units, use absorbent layers between crates.
  • Leak containment trays — when shipping multiple units on a pallet, use a spill tray or pallet liner to contain any leakage.
  • Clearly mark as heavy and include handling instructions: “THIS SIDE UP” and “DO NOT ROLL”.

Corrosion protection that actually works

Wet-dry vacs have metal components and fasteners that rust quickly if even a film of water remains. Corrosion often shows up weeks after transit — after the carrier dispute window closed.

Best practices

  • VCI (volatile corrosion inhibitor) bags — place the unit or metal components in VCI bags to release protective vapors during transit.
  • Light protective coatings — for returned or high-risk units, a thin, removable anti-corrosion spray on motor mounts and exposed fasteners helps. Use manufacturer-approved products only.
  • Silica gel and humidity indicators — add a humidity indicator card inside the bag to show the receiving party if moisture was present in transit.

Battery and hazardous-materials rules (short and critical)

If your wet-dry vac contains a removable battery pack or fuel-powered components, you must follow dangerous-goods rules. In 2026 carriers and marketplaces continue strict enforcement:

  • Remove lithium-ion batteries when possible and ship separately following IATA (air) and 49 CFR (ground) rules.
  • If batteries remain installed, label and document them correctly; some carriers will refuse transport.
  • Never ship a unit with fuel, oil, or flammable cleaning agents inside the tank.

Consult carrier hazardous materials guidance before booking a shipment.

Packing heavy items: pallets, banding and center-of-gravity control

Wet-dry vacs, especially commercial models, are heavy and have awkward centers of gravity. Proper palletization reduces damage and carrier disputes.

  • Use the right pallet size — the base should be fully supported. Never overhang the pallet edge.
  • Stiffen with corner boards — protect edges and distribute strap pressure.
  • Strap, then wrap — use steel or polyester banding for initial hold, then heavy-gauge stretch film to stabilize.
  • Top and bottom protection — protect from puncture with skid mats or slip sheets.
  • Label weight and lifting points — provide clear forklift instructions and center-of-gravity markers.

Returns and claims: how to reduce denials and speed refunds

Claims escalations are expensive. Prevent them at the packaging stage, then prepare to document and respond quickly if a claim arises.

Pre-return guidance for sellers

  • Give customers clear RMA instructions: drain, detach battery, bag and secure the unit before returning.
  • Offer local drop-off or in-store returns to avoid shipping risks for large units.
  • Provide a packing-kit option for high-value vacs (sealed bag + desiccant + absorbent pad + instructions).

Documenting for carrier claims

When damage occurs, carriers now often require photographic evidence showing the pre‑shipping condition. Prepare a standardized claims packet:

  1. Time-stamped photos of the unit drained and sealed, showing serial numbers.
  2. Photos of packing steps: absorbent pad in place, sealed bags, desiccant and VCI bag.
  3. Carrier tracking info and date/time of tender/drop-off.
  4. RMA or inspection report noting whether the unit was shipped with liquid or batteries installed.
Pro tip: keep a secure repository of packing photos linked to each shipment ID — most carriers accept digital evidence during claims intake.

Advanced strategies (worth it for high-value inventory)

If you ship premium or high-volume wet-dry vacs, invest in these higher-tier protections:

  • Smart sensors — low-cost shock and humidity loggers that record transit conditions and provide tamper-evident data for claims.
  • Moisture indicator cards — visually show if humidity exceeded safe levels during transit.
  • Custom foam cradles — engineered to support heavy centers of gravity and reduce stress on internal seals.
  • Transit insurance with clear liability terms — declare “dry” and show prep documentation to protect against denials.

Common mistakes that lead to denied claims

  • Shipping with residual liquid in the tank or hoses.
  • Failing to remove or document batteries.
  • Using only single-layer plastic bags or no absorbents.
  • No photographic proof of pre-shipment condition.
  • Poor palletization: overhang, insufficient strapping, or no corner protection.
